摘  要:
针对目前国内沼气池存在的建池周期长、产气率低、受季节影响大等问题,依据北方地区生产实践研究设计出一种新型太阳能玻璃钢沼气罐。结合国际上先进的玻璃钢罐螺旋工艺技术,采用分体结构,并用太阳能热水循环系统提高玻璃钢沼气池的罐体温度和产气率,较好地解决了北方冬季产气问题。

摘  要:
Presently, developing biogas digester in our country has some problems, such as ,the period of building a digester is too long, biogas output is low and it can't produce biogas normally in winter .etc, Aimed at these problems, in this paper, we designed a new solar FRP biogas digester according to the production condition in the northern region, combining with the advanced FRP helix craft technique ,adopting fission structure, and using solar energy hot water circulatory system to rise the temperature of FRP digester for improving biogas output, it solves the biogas product problem better.
